Package org.apache.wicket.protocol.http

Examples of org.apache.wicket.protocol.http.WebRequestCycle.urlFor()


    ResourceReference rr = new ResourceReference("test");
    CharSequence url = cycle.urlFor(rr,new ValueMap("param=value",""));
    assertEquals("resources/org.apache.wicket.Application/test?param=value", url);

    rr = new ResourceReference(SharedResourceUrlTest.class,"test");
    url = cycle.urlFor(rr,new ValueMap("param=value",""));
    assertEquals("resources/org.apache.wicket.SharedResourceUrlTest/test?param=value", url);
 

}
View Full Code Here


  {
    tester.setupRequestAndResponse();
   
    WebRequestCycle cycle = tester.createRequestCycle();
   
    String url =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ableHomePageLinksPage.class,null)).toString();

    tester.setupRequestAndResponse();
    tester.getServletRequest().setURL("/WicketTester$DummyWebApplication/WicketTester$DummyWebApplication/" + url);
   
    tester.processRequestCycle();
View Full Code Here

  {
    tester.setupRequestAndResponse();
   
    WebRequestCycle cycle = tester.createRequestCycle();
   
    String url =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ableThrowsInterceptPage.class,null)).toString();
    String url2 =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ableContinueToPage.class,null)).toString();

    tester.setupRequestAndResponse();
    tester.getServletRequest().setURL("/WicketTester$DummyWebApplication/WicketTester$DummyWebApplication/" + url);
    tester.processRequestCycle();
View Full Code Here

    tester.setupRequestAndResponse();
   
    WebRequestCycle cycle = tester.createRequestCycle();
   
    String url =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ableThrowsInterceptPage.class,null)).toString();
    String url2 =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ableContinueToPage.class,null)).toString();

    tester.setupRequestAndResponse();
    tester.getServletRequest().setURL("/WicketTester$DummyWebApplication/WicketTester$DummyWebApplication/" + url);
    tester.processRequestCycle();
   
View Full Code Here

   
    WebRequestCycle cycle = tester.createRequestCycle();
   
    PageParameters pp = new PageParameters();
    pp.put("test", "test");
    String url =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ableThrowsInterceptPage.class,pp)).toString();
    String url2 =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ableContinueToPage.class,null)).toString();

    tester.setupRequestAndResponse();
    tester.getServletRequest().setURL("/WicketTester$DummyWebApplication/WicketTester$DummyWebApplication/" + url);
    tester.processRequestCycle();
View Full Code Here

    WebRequestCycle cycle = tester.createRequestCycle();
   
    PageParameters pp = new PageParameters();
    pp.put("test", "test");
    String url =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ableThrowsInterceptPage.class,pp)).toString();
    String url2 = cycle.urlFor(new BookmarkablePageRequestTarget(BookmarkableContinueToPage.class,null)).toString();

    tester.setupRequestAndResponse();
    tester.getServletRequest().setURL("/WicketTester$DummyWebApplication/WicketTester$DummyWebApplication/" + url);
    tester.processRequestCycle();
   
View Full Code Here

    PageParameters parameters = new PageParameters();
    parameters.add("0", "Integer0");
    parameters.add("1", "Integer1");
    parameters.add("2", "a:b");

    String url1 = cycle.urlFor(
        new BookmarkablePageRequestTarget(BookmarkableHomePageLinksPage.class, parameters))
        .toString();
    String url2 = cycle.urlFor(
        new BookmarkablePageRequestTarget("mypagemap", BookmarkableHomePageLinksPage.class,
            parameters)).toString();
View Full Code Here

    parameters.add("2", "a:b");

    String url1 = cycle.urlFor(
        new BookmarkablePageRequestTarget(BookmarkableHomePageLinksPage.class, parameters))
        .toString();
    String url2 = cycle.urlFor(
        new BookmarkablePageRequestTarget("mypagemap", BookmarkableHomePageLinksPage.class,
            parameters)).toString();
    assertEquals("test1/Integer0/Integer1/a%3Ab/", url1);
    assertEquals("test2/Integer0/Integer1/a%3Ab/wicket:pageMapName/mypagemap/", url2);
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.